ENGINE ANTI-ICE -ENGINE COMPONENT LOCATIONS
Component Locations
The engine anti-ice (EAI) components are in these locations:
*
Engine core -left side
*
Engine fan case -right side
*
Engine inlet -left side.
These are the components on the engine core:
*
EAI valve
*
EAI duct
*
Controller air cooler.
These are the components on the engine fan case:
*
EAI valve controller
*
EAI pressure sensors
*
EAI duct.
The left side of the engine inlet has the EAI exhaust port.

ENGINE ANTI-ICE -EAI VALVE
Purpose
The EAI valve controls the flow of engine bleed air though the EAI duct to the engine cowl leading edge.
Physical Description
The EAI valve is a pneumatically-operated, piston-type valve. The valve has these parts:
*
Body
*
Locking screw
*
Locking crank
*
Control pressure line connector.
Location
The EAI valve is on the left side of the engine core at the 8:00 position. The valve is in the EAI duct above the integrated drive generator (IDG), aft of the gearbox.
Functional Description
The piston freely slides on the guide tube. Control pressure pushes on the inner part of the piston to open the valve and control flow. Air from the high pressure bleed air source pushes on the outer part of the piston to move it to the closed position.
The locking screw and locking crank let you manually set the EAI valve for normal operation (unlocked position) or to the locked closed position. The locking screw keeps the locking crank in its unlocked position for normal valve operation or in the valve locked closed position. When you remove the screw from its stowed position, it lets control pressure vent and the locking crank move. When you move the locking crank to CLOSED and install the locking screw, the crank holds the piston in the closed position.
Training Information Point
You use the EAI valve controller (not shown) to manually set the EAI valve open.
See the procedure in part II of the AMM, Preparation -Engine Anti-ice Systems Inoperative, for more information on deactivation of the engine anti-ice valve open.
